Output 249e7104ab3f78d0b443a3f06a26ea32c332c27b846cf54612854b4b9a3e5761:2

value
36101083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0343b070491b1b13b01b89ca98e01985192640a OP_EQUAL
address
MULeASieirtKAuAcp24u4UiVETfpuA5i4F
transaction
249e7104ab3f78d0b443a3f06a26ea32c332c27b846cf54612854b4b9a3e5761
spent
true